Potty Training: How much water should a puppy drink during potty training
On any typical day with moderate exercise and play, your puppy should be drinking 0.5 to 1.0 ounces of water for every pound of body weight Let’s say, for example, that you have a 10-pound puppy. They should be drinking five to 10 ounces of water to stay well-hydrated and healthy.

Week Old Puppies Pee: How often do 8 week old puppies pee at night
If you start him when he’s 7-9 weeks old, it’ll probably need to be every 2 hours ; from 9-14 weeks, every 3 hours; 14 weeks and up, every 4 hours. These are general guidelines, of course, and you may find that your puppy needs to go out more or less frequently.

Is it OK to withhold water from a dog at night?
Night:
As a rule of thumb, remove the food and water bowls about two-to-three hours before bedtime So, if your lights-out time is at 11 p.m., a puppy should have no food or water after about 8–8:30 p.m. This gives you a chance to take him out for a one last potty break before settling in for the night.

Artificial Grass: How do you get dog poop smell out of artificial grass
Start by hosing off the area with a garden hose. Then, make a vinegar solution of equal parts of vinegar and water. Spray the area with this solution and rinse with clean water Vinegar is a non-toxic, natural deodorizer that is safe for children and pets.
